Abstract Introduction: Conflicting results have been reported for the prognostic value of LAMs and Tregs in FL. A recent study from the SWOG suggested that survival for pts with FL has improved in the last 30 years, possibly due to the introduction of MoAb-based therapy. We examined the prognostic significance of LAMs and FOX-P3-positive Tregs using tissue microarrays (TMAs) from pts entered onto SWOG studies 8809 (no MoAb) and 9911chemotherapy followed by (including 131I-tositumomab). Pts & methods: Adequate tissue samples were identified from 87 pts on SWOG 8809 and 47 on 9911. Pt characteristics were as follows: 8809: median age - 47.4 yrs (26.1 – 69.4), male 53%, Follicular Lymphoma International Prognostic Index (FLIPI) score: 1–36%, 2–39%, 3–21%. 9911: median age - 49.9 (22.9 – 66.8), male-60%, FLIPI score: 1–36%, 2–45%, 9–19%. The pts with available tissue were comparable with those who did not have available tissue for clinical prognostic factors. Archival blocks were reviewed to confirm FL and to assess for preparation of TMAs containing two 1mm diameter cores per case. Automated immunostaining for CD68 (PGM1) and FOXP3 (236A/E7) was performed. Intrafollicular (IF) and extra follicular (EF) LAMs were quantitated by manual count (5 1000x high power fields [hpf]). FOXP3 was scored for pattern (follicular/perfollicular vs. other) and number/5 hpf .LAM and Treg numbers/patterns were correlated with OS Marker levels were categorized by medians, 3rd quartiles and as continuous variables. Survival differences by marker level/pattern were assessed within each study population by Cox regression. Results: Pt characteristics did not differ by SWOG study. Hazard ratios with 95% confidence intervals for OS according to FOX-P3 and CD68 staining are shown in table 1. LAMS were not associated with OS, except for IF LAMS in S9911. Levels or pattern of FOX-P3 staining were not associated with OS. Conclusion: Levels of LAMs and Tregs were not predictive of overall survival in FL pts on SWOG trials before and after the introduction of anti-CD20 radio-immunotherapy (RIT). While IF LAMs in pts receiving RIT may be associated with shorter OS, the number of cases/events is too small for firm conclusions. Further studies are required to determine the prognostic value of these biomarkers in FL patients receiving anti-CD20 MoAb-containing therapies. Abstract The tumor microenvironment plays an important role in the biologic behavior of follicular lymphoma (FL), but the specific cell subsets involved in this regulation are unknown. To determine the impact of FOXP3-positive regulatory T cells (Tregs) in the progression and outcome of FL patients, we examined samples from 97 patients at diagnosis and 37 at first relapse with an anti-FOXP3 monoclonal antibody. Tregs were quantified using computerized image analysis. The median overall survival (OS) of the series was 9.9 years, and the FL International Prognostic Index (FLIPI) was prognostically significant. The median Treg percentage at diagnosis was 10.5%. Overall, 49 patients had more than 10% Tregs, 30 between 5% to 10%, and 19 less than 5%, with a 5-year OS of 80%, 74%, and 50%, respectively (P = .001). Patients with very low numbers of Tregs (< 5%) presented more frequently with refractory disease (P = .007). The prognostic significance of Treg numbers was independent of the FLIPI. Seven transformed diffuse large B-cell lymphomas (DLBCLs) had lower Treg percentages (mean: 3.3%) than FL grades 1,2 (mean: 12.1%) or 3 (mean: 9%) (P < .02). In conclusion, high Treg numbers predict improved survival of FL patients, while a marked reduction in Tregs is observed on transformation to DLBCL.

Background. Bone marrow is the mostfrequent metastatic site in follicular lymphoma, 40-70 % cases. It’s unfovourable prognostic role is stated in the index FLIPI-2 (Follicular Lymphoma International Prognostic Index-2). Objective. To study both prognostic role of bone marrow involvement and it’s relation to erythropoiesis peculiarities in follicular lymphoma was the purpose of this research. Materials and methods. Histological study was performed in 269 follicular lymphoma patients. Erythropoiesis peculiarities were studied in that patients according to standard myelogram analysis. Results. Bone marrow involvement was noted according to trephine biopsy section staining in 37,9 % of follicular lymphoma case (102 from 269). Bone marrow involvement did not influenced the prognosis (overall survival) in all period of observation (p = 0,18). Longterm survival (more than 48 months) was negatively influenced by bone marrow involvement (p = 0,04). Intertrabecular pattern of follicular lymphoma growth in bone marrow was negative prognostic factor (p = 0,02). We noted negative correlation between bone marrow involvement and the elevation of orthochromic normoblasts in bone marrow of patients with follicular lymphoma. In cause of bone marrow such elevation was noted in 67 %, and in the absense of involvement - in 78 % (p = 0,043). Elevation of orthochromic normoblasts did not influenced the overall survival of follicular lymphoma patients (p = 0,89). Conclusion. Bone marrow involvement in follicular lymphoma plays prognostically unfavourable role in long-time observation periods (later than 48 months). The most unfavourable are the intertrabecular patchy lesions. Involvement of bone marrow is in opposite relations to elevation of orthochromic normoblast, but the latter sign is of no prognostic significance.

Abstract bcl-xL, a member of the Bcl-2 family, exerts an antiapoptotic effect on lymphocytes. To assess its clinical significance in patients with follicular lymphoma, realtime quantitative reverse transcription–polymerase chain reaction (RT-PCR) analysis of bcl-xL gene expression was investigated in whole lymph node sections and laser-microdissected lymphoma cells of 27 patients. Compared with 10 patients with reactive follicular hyperplasia, the bcl-xL gene was overexpressed in patients with follicular lymphoma at a higher level in microdissected lymphoma cells. The bcl-xL gene level correlated with the number of apoptotic lymphoma cells labeled by terminal deoxytransferase-catalyzed DNA nick-end labeling (TUNEL) assays (r = -0.7736). Clinically, a high bcl-xL level was significantly associated with multiple sites of extranodal involvement (P = .0020), elevated lactate dehydrogenase level (P = .0478), and an International Prognostic Index indicating high risk (P = .0235). Moreover, bcl-xL gene overexpression was linked to short overall survival times (P = .0129). The value of bcl-xL gene expression as a prognostic marker in follicular lymphoma should thus be considered.

Background/Aim. The widely accepted Follicular Lymphoma International Prognostic Index (FLIPI) divides patients into three risk groups based on the score of adverse prognostic factors. The estimated 5-year survival in patients with a high FLIPI score is around 50%. The aim of this study was to analyse the prognostic value of clinical and laboratory parameters that are not included in the FLIPI and the New Prognostic Index for Follicular Lymphoma developed by the International Follicular Lymphoma Prognostic Factor Project (FLIPI2) indices, in follicular lymphoma (FL) patients with a high FLIPI score and high tumor burden. Methods. The retrospective analysis included 57 newly diagnosed patients with FL, a high FLIPI score and a high tumor burden. All the patients were diagnosed and treated between April 2000 and June 2007 at the Clinic for Hematology, Clinical Center of Serbia, Belgrade. Results. The patients with a histological grade > 1, erythrocyte sedimentation rate (ESR) ? 45 mm/h and hypoalbuminemia had a significantly worse overall survival (p = 0.015; p = 0.001; p = 0.008, respectively), while there was a tendency toward worse overall survival in the patients with an Eastern Cooperative Oncology Group (ECOG) > 1 (p = 0.075). Multivariate Cox regression analysis identified a histological grade > 1, ESR ? 45 mm/h and hypoalbuminemia as independent risk factors for a poor outcome. Based on a cumulative score of unfavourable prognostic factors, patients who had 0 or 1 unfavourable factors had a significantly better 5-year overall survival compared to patients with 2 or 3 risk factors (75% vs 24.1%, p = 0.000). Conclusion. The obtained results suggest that from the examined prognostic parameters histological grade > 1, ESR ? 45 mm/h and hypoalbuminemia can contribute in defining patients who need more aggressive initial treatment approach, if two or three of these parameters are present on presentation.

Abstract Follicular lymphoma (FL) patients, (pts) with high-risk features using the FL International Prognostic Index (FLIPI) have an expected 5-year survival of only about 50% with conventional therapy. With the incorporation of anti-CD20 monoclonal antibody (mAb) therapy, results are improving (e.g., Buske, Blood2006; 108: 1504). Starting in 2003, we have treated high-risk (FLIPI ≥3) FL pts with R-FND (rituximab, fludarabine, mitoxantrone, dexamethasone) for 4 cycles, followed by radioimmunotherapy (RIT) with ibritumomab tiuxetan, and subsequent rituximab maintenance. Results for the first 35 pts are: complete (CR) and partial (PR) remission 83% and 14%; 3-year overall (OS) and failure-free survival (FFS) 89% and 74% (median follow-up 24 mo.). RIT converted 5 PR pts to CR. Toxicity was mainly hematologic. Five pts did not receive RIT, one because of neutropenia after R-FND. Following RIT, platelet and neutrophil nadirs were 28 and 0.3, occurring at 4–7 weeks. 16 pts required transfusions, and 27 received growth factors. 13 pts had infections, only 2 of which were grade 3. Recovery occurred by 3 weeks in most, with prolonged cytopenias in 6. There has been 1 case of myelodysplasia. In conclusion, the additional complexity of this RIT intensification strategy is warranted in this high-risk FL population, resulting in OS and FFS outcomes that are better than non-mAb therapies, and at least as good as published chemotherapy-rituximab combination therapy.

Abstract Follicular lymphoma (FL) is a low-grade B-cell lymphoma, and the response of FL to treatment, as well as progression-free survival and overall survival (OS), are improved by the application of combined chemotherapy with rituximab (R). The cyclophosphamide, adriamycin, vincristine, and prednisolone with rituximab (R-CHOP) regimen is the standard first-line therapy for patients with FL. However, many patients have coexistent diseases (comorbidities), and it is believed that therapeutic decision-making is influenced by comorbidities. In this study, we retrospectively analyzed treatment decision-making and its outcome for patients with FL. Based on this analysis, we investigated how the presence of comorbidity affects the survival of patients with FL. We analyzed 113 patients who were diagnosed with FL at our institute between September 2001 and March 2014. The treatment strategy was classified as observation without treatment, chemotherapy, radiotherapy, and others. Chemotherapy was subclassified as R-CHOP, reduced R-CHOP (the chemotherapeutic dose was reduced), and other chemotherapy. The severity of the comorbidity present at the time of diagnosis of FL was estimated according to the Charlson Comorbidity Index (CCI) (Table 1). The clinical characteristics of the 113 patients are shown in Table 2. The median age of the patients was 60 years. Six patients were observed without treatment, and 8 patients underwent resection or localized radiation for lymphoma. R-CHOP and other chemotherapy regimens were utilized in 84, and 15 patients, respectively. The 5-year OS rates of patients treated with R-CHOP, reduced R-CHOP, and other chemotherapy regimens were 92.3%, 75.5%, and 74.1%, respectively. As shown in a previous study (Andre Wieringa, et al., Br J Haematol, 2014, 165, 489-496), the 5-year OS rate of patients with CCI score ≥2 was inferior to that of patients with CCI 0-1 (CCI ≥2 (n = 32); 76.5%, CCI 0-1(n=81); 92.4%, p = 0.0361, Figure 1a). When we analyze the patients treated with R-CHOP, the overall response rate was 92.4% (complete response [CR] = 77.2%, partial response [PR] = 15.1%) in patients with a CCI score of 0-1 and 94.4% (CR = 77.8%, PR = 16.7%) in those with CCI score ≥ 2. In addition, there was no significant difference in the 5-year OS rate between patients with a CCI score of 0-1 or ≥2 (91.0% vs. 85.0%, p = 0.779, Figure 1b). Although, the percentage of patients with CCI ≥2 is lower than that of the other therapies (CCI ≥2; R-CHOP 25%, other chemotherapy 67%), it is supposed that R-CHOP is effective even if the patients have severe comorbidities. In 6 patients among these, treatment was discontinued or the chemotherapeutic dose was reduced due to myelosuppression during the designated course of therapy .The 5-year OS rate of these patients was favorable, even among those with high CCI score(CCI 0,1; 94.1%, CCI ≥2; 100%). Thus, it appears that R-CHOP with appropriate dose modification during the designated course will improve patient survival. Our results indicate that patients with severe comorbidities can be treated effectively by adjusting R-CHOP. Table 1. 4530 Background: ICIs demonstrated improved overall survival (OS) in heavily pre-treated mGOJ/GC pts. Pts selection exclusively based on PD-L1 tissue expression appears to be suboptimal, despite data from subgroup analyses of KEYNOTE trials. Strong rationale suggests a potential predictive role of inflammatory biomarkers in ICIs treated mGOJ/GC pts. Methods: Ten systemic inflammatory markers [platelets, monocytes, neutrophil/lymphocyte ratio (NLR), platelets-lymphocyte ratio, lymphocytes, sum of mononuclear cells, albumin, lactate dehydrogenase, c-reactive protein (CRP) and serum globulin] were retrospectively analyzed at baseline in 57 mGOJ/GC pts with unknown PD-L1 status treated in second-line with ICIs, and correlated with OS. Least Absolute Shrinkage and Selection Operator (LASSO) method was used to select variables (preliminarily subject to optimal coding using HR smoothed curves for OS) with the highest prognostic value. Selected variables were then analyzed in a multivariate Cox Regression Model and used to build a GIPI nomogram. Results: NLR and CRP taken as continuous variables and albumin categorized as < vs > 30 g/dL were found as the most meaningful independent predictors of OS and used to build the GIPI nomogram. Nomogram-based lowest (l), mid-low, mid-high and highest (h) risk quartiles were associated with median(m)OS of 14.9, 7.1, 5.6 and 2.1 months (mos), respectively [HR of l vs h 4.94, p 0.0002]. By optimally dichotomizing CRP and NLR, pts with one or more of the following risk factors: NLR >6, CRP >15 mg/L, albumin <30 g/dL (n: 29) had a mOS of 3.9 mos vs 14.2 mos of pts with no risk factor (n: 28) (HR 2.48, p 0.001). Conclusions: GIPI, combining NLR, CRP and Albumin, is the first inflammatory index with a significant prognostic value in mOGJ/GC pts receiving second-line ICIs. Its implementation in correlation with PD-L1 expression in the present cohort is ongoing. GIPI merits validation in independent cohorts and prospective clinical trials.

Abstract Abstract 1641 Background: The World Health Organization (WHO) classification allocates indolent follicular lymphoma to grades 1, 2 or 3A according to the proportions of small centrocytes and large centroblasts in the neoplastic follicles. The prognostic value of the WHO's grading system in indolent follicular lymphoma has not been investigated in patients given the anti-CD20 monoclonal antibody rituximab without chemotherapy. Methods: We prospectively reviewed the follicular lymphoma grades in 276 grade 1–3A patients who received upfront rituximab without chemotherapy in two randomized trials. Flow cytometry analyses of malignant and nonmalignant lymphocyte subsets in lymph nodes and blood were also assessed. Results: In these patients given upfront rituximab-containing therapy, increasing grades of 1, 2, and 3A correlated with longer time to treatment-failure (P =0.002) and overall survival (P =0.045), independently of clinical factors (including the follicular lymphoma international prognostic index). The grades' impact was also independent of the levels of CD3+, CD4+, and CD8+ T cells in lymph nodes and in blood. Conclusion: Increasing grades of indolent follicular lymphoma correlate with better outcome in patients treated upfront with rituximab without chemotherapy, independently of clinical and immunologic factors. This suggests that treatment with rituximab acts differentially in tumors depending on the centrocyte/centroblast ratio. Disclosures: No relevant conflicts of interest to declare.

Abstract Follicular lymphoma (FL) is the most common indolent lymphoma with a median survival approaching 20 years. However, there is significant clinical heterogeneity with subsets of patients experiencing transformation, early recurrence or refractory disease. Some authors found that progression of disease within 24 months of diagnosis, in patients treated with chemoimmunotherapy (POD24), is associated with poor overall survival (OS). OBJECTIVE Evaluate the POD24 as an early clinical endpoint in FL and evaluate FL international prognostic index (FLIPI), and other baseline risk factors at diagnosis for overall survival and relapse. METHODS We conducted a retrospective and observational study in which 160 patients with follicular lymphoma who received R-CHOP at National Institute of Cancerology, Mexico from 2011 to 2017. We analyze with Kaplan Meier curves, log rank test and logistic regression model. RESULTS We analyze 160 patients, median of age was 53 years (26- 88), with a female : male ratio of 1.17:1. In this group: 86% had hemoglobin >12 mg/dL, LDH was normal in 62%, 1-4 nodal areas were affected in 64%, 56% of patients had high FLIPI score, 27% had B symptoms and we found bone marrow infiltration in 30% of cases; grade 2 Follicular lymphoma was the most common histological subtype (40.5%). Most of patients achieved complete response (81%), 12% partial response after the first line therapy. Only 13 patients (8%) presents relapse. Sixty four percent received maintenance. Only 13 of patients relapsed, 10 after 24 months and only 3 in first 24 months from diagnostic (POD 24). Fig. 1 Overall survival in our population was 89% to 8 years, the factors with statistical significance in the bivariate analysis were the more nodal regions affected (1-4), high FLIPI score and POD 24 POD 24, adjusted to FLIPI score, was an independent predictor of survival in regression analysis (p<0.041, HR:35 IC 95% 1.15-1060.21). The bone marrow infiltration at diagnosis was the only independent predictor for relapse (p<0.007, HR: 6.9, IC 95% 1.7- 28.2). CONCLUSION: In our study group, POD 24, was an important predictor of overall survival, and bone marrow infiltration at diagnosis was the only predictor factor for relapse. Purpose A prognostic index for AIDS-associated Kaposi's sarcoma (KS) diagnosed in the era of highly active antiretroviral therapy (HAART) was based on routine clinical and laboratory characteristics. Because immune subset measurement is often performed in HIV-positive individuals, we examined whether these were predictive of mortality independently of the prognostic index, or could predict time to progression of KS. Patients and Methods We performed univariate and multivariate Cox regression analyses on a data set of 326 individuals with AIDS-associated KS to identify immune subset covariates predictive of overall survival and time to progression. Adaptive (CD8 T cell and CD19 B cell) and innate (CD16/56 natural-killer cell) immune parameters were studied by flow cytometry. Results In univariate analyses, all three immune subsets had significant effects on overall survival (P < .025). In multivariate analyses including the prognostic index, only CD8 counts remained significant (P = .026), although its effect on the overall prognostic index is small. An increase of 100 cells/mm3 in the CD8 count confers a 5% improvement in overall survival. Individuals with a higher CD8 count did not have an increased time to progression. Patients who were already on HAART at the time of KS diagnosis did not have a shorter time to progression than those who were antiretroviral naïve at KS diagnosis. Conclusion The CD8 count appears to provide independent prognostic information in individuals with AIDS-associated KS. Measurement of the CD8 count is clinically useful in patients with KS.
